The Hollywood African Cinema Connection HACC is poised to make a significant cultural impact this year as it expands its festival to two dynamic and historic venues in Cape Town.

With a promise of bigger and bolder programming, the festival will showcase an exceptional lineup of African films accompanied by thought-provoking panel discussions. Bringing together celebrated and emerging voices from across the continent, HACCs festival offers a captivating platform for the creativity that defines modern African cinema.

Taking place at the renowned Desmond and Leah Tutu Foundation on Longmarket Street, alongside The District Six Museum Homecoming Centre, previously the Fugard Theatre in Caledon Street, the event is set to reflect Cape Towns rich history and vibrant cultural pulse.

As attendees step into these iconic locations , they'll be immersed in the perfect backdrop for celebrating cinema and culture like never before.

This years festival programme has officially launched, featuring a stellar collection of films that highlight the diverse and groundbreaking work emerging from Africa.
